"Hello, world" -- although any program should trigger the same bug
Something seems to be screwed up with the way the x86_64 code generator is
mapping metadata to assembly directives. The following works fine:
$ clang -emit-llvm -S -o hello.ll hello.c
$ llvm-as hello.ll
$ llvm-ld -native -o hello hello.bc
However, when I compile with -g, badness happens:
$ clang -g -emit-llvm -S -o hello.ll hello.c
$ llvm-as hello.ll
$ llvm-ld -native -o hello hello.bc
hello.s: Assembler messages:
hello.s:2: Error: junk at end of line, first unrecognized character is `"'
llvm-ld:
$ head hello.s
.file "hello.bc"
.file 1 "/tmp" "hello.c"
.section .debug_info,"",@progbits
.Lsection_info:
.section .debug_abbrev,"",@progbits
.Lsection_abbrev:
.section .debug_aranges,"",@progbits
.section .debug_macinfo,"",@progbits
.section .debug_line,"",@progbits
.Lsection_line:
